The Alabama Fishing Show & Expo is an 'everything fishing’, and fun for all ages show and expo!SHELLCRACKER - REDEAR SUNFISH INFORMATION PAGE. The Shellcracker goes by a number of names, including Redear Sunfish, Sun Perch and Georgia Bream. Shellcracker resembles a Bluegill but is somewhat larger, averaging 7″-9″ in length. They like warm, quiet water near logs and vegetation. With over 250 different species of fish, it’s …Walleye like deep, cool, flowing water. In Alabama, anglers normally find them in tailraces below dams that release chilly water from the bottom of deep reservoirs, creating strong currents. Walleye can grow more than 30 inches long. Some top locations include Mobile Bay, Wheeler Lake, Lewis Smith Lake, MudCreek, …That is why we have some fish with slot sizes where you can only keep one fish over a certain size. This has been the case for red drum for a long time. We added a slot limit for spotted sea trout (speckled trout) a couple of years ago. Rivers and the Mobile …Channel Catfish in ponds average 10″ to 30″ long and weigh up to 30 pounds. Some have topped out at 40 to 50 lbs. Make a point to fish out your Catfish by the time they are about 2 lbs in size or they become eating machines. Sturgeon are covered with bony plates, not scales like most commonly known fish. Gulf Sturgeon, Acipenser oxyrinchus desotoi, is a threatened species which can be found in Alabama’s large rivers, such as the Tombigbee and Alabama Rivers. This sturgeon is ...
